Tracking Niger's Uranium and Mining Sector Online

Few extractive sectors anywhere are watched as closely as Niger's uranium fields around Arlit and Agadez, long tied to operators like Orano and increasingly to Chinese and Russian interests. The licensing notices, ministry communiques, and tender documents that signal a shift in ownership are published from inside the country, often on government portals that geo-filter or rate-limit foreign traffic. Datacenter Niger proxies handle the bulk crawl of these public registers; a residential exit is what you switch to when a Ministere des Mines site inspects the connection before serving content. Commodity desks and geopolitical analysts use that combination to read the same pages a clerk in Niamey loads, rather than a cached or blocked copy. The payoff is timing: catching a permit reassignment when it posts, not weeks later through a wire summary.

Reaching the Journal Officiel and Douanes Portals as a Local User

Public-sector data in Niger sits behind sites built for domestic users: the Journal Officiel, customs schedules at the Direction Generale des Douanes, and procurement tenders that often render slowly or refuse connections from outside West Africa. A Niger IP address lets compliance and trade teams open those pages directly, in French, with the in-country layout intact. Rotating proxies suit a broad sweep of tender listings across ministries; a sticky session held steady for a longer crawl fits a single portal that tracks a session. Country and ASN selection sit in the proxy username at no extra cost, and analysts collect tender and tariff data the way a procurement officer in Niamey would, without the foreign-traffic filters that distort or deny the response.

Mobile-First Access and Wallet Onboarding in a Cash-Light Economy

Internet in Niger is overwhelmingly mobile, carried by Airtel and Moov Africa, and so is money movement, with mobile-money wallets layered over those same SIMs. A registration or top-up flow on such a wallet often stalls or refuses traffic that arrives from outside the country, so the geo-gated step never surfaces from a desk abroad. Fintech and inclusion researchers reach for residential or mobile Niger proxies to walk that onboarding as a Maradi or Zinder subscriber would, on the carrier ranges these apps expect to see. A phone-network exit carries the most credibility where the wallet checks the connecting network before opening the next step. The result is an honest read of what a user on a handset actually meets, which is the only read that matters for an access or pricing study in this market.

Development and Diaspora Data Collection Across the Sahel

Humanitarian and development programs anchor much of Niger's online presence, and the operational data behind them lives on platforms tuned to the country: OCHA and WFP food-security dashboards, REACH bulletins, and local outlets reporting in French and Hausa. Researchers and the Nigerien diaspora abroad often find these resources throttled or regionally gated. Niger proxies give development analysts an in-country vantage point to gather public reporting for needs assessments and program monitoring, and let diaspora users reach local services as residents do. Worked against public sources within each site's terms, the in-country addresses turn fragmented Sahelian reporting into something a research team can assemble, whether the desk sits in Niamey, Zinder, or Paris.
